Enhanced Efficiency Through Accessibility 


One of the most compelling reasons to consider cloud payroll is its ability to enhance operational efficiency. Unlike traditional systems that require on-premise hardware and software, cloud payroll solutions allow access from anywhere as long as you have an internet connection. This flexibility is invaluable, particularly for teams that operate across multiple locations or require remote access. Imagine being able to conduct payroll processing for transport or manage employee onboarding from your home office or whilst travelling. Cloud solutions eliminate barriers, ensuring payroll tasks are executed seamlessly and on time. 

 

Real-Time Data: Making Informed Decisions 


Furthermore, cloud payroll systems provide a single source of information, which reduces the likelihood of data inaccuracies and discrepancies. Real-time access to payroll data means you can easily monitor your labour costs and make informed decisions regarding budgeting and resource allocation. For instance, payroll software for financial services can provide instant insights, enabling your company to align its financial strategies with actual payroll expenditures. Most systems also offer customisable reporting features to make it easier to identify trends and forecast future expenses. 

 

Cost-Effective Solutions for Growing Businesses 


Cost-effectiveness is another significant advantage of cloud payroll solutions that should not be overlooked. While traditional payroll software often involves substantial upfront costs for hardware and ongoing maintenance, cloud-based systems operate on a subscription model, allowing businesses like yours to scale services as needed. Whether your company is experiencing growth or maintaining a steady size, you can adjust your payroll software subscription accordingly to ensure you're only paying for what you need. Such flexible workforce management options can be particularly beneficial for small companies looking to optimise their expenses without sacrificing quality.

Staying Compliant in a Complex World 


Employment regulations and tax obligations are constantly evolving, and staying compliant is essential for avoiding penalties that can hurt your bottom line. Cloud payroll systems are designed to automatically update to reflect the latest legislation, ensuring that your company remains compliant with all relevant laws. This feature is particularly important for sectors like mining and transport, where regulatory requirements are quite stringent.  

 

Empowering Employees Through Self-Service 


Another key benefit of cloud workforce management is the provision of self-service portals. These portals empower employees to manage their own payroll information, view payslips, and update personal details. This autonomy not only improves employee satisfaction but also reduces the administrative burden on your HR departments.  


Efficient employee timesheet management becomes effortless, with staff able to submit their hours and expenses digitally, and facilitates an overall smoother payroll process. Furthermore, when employees feel in control of their information, it fosters a more positive workplace culture, which is invaluable for team morale and productivity. The platform's intuitive design ensures that even team members with minimal technical expertise can navigate the system effectively, and its mobile-friendly interface allows employees to access their information securely from any device.
